OpenWrt

No support found. Checked against OpenWrt's own Table of Hardware, which carries no qualifying row for this model. That is a weaker statement than "this router cannot run OpenWrt" and a much stronger one than silence.

No ToH row for any current Ubiquiti entry. The UniFi gateway line runs UniFi OS on proprietary hardware, and OpenWrt's Ubiquiti coverage is entirely older AirMax and UniFi AP gear.
